Antropología Bech
About the Item
Antropología is a minimal furniture collection created by Mexico City-based designer Raul de la Cerda for BREUER. BREUER is the leading company in design and manufacturing of custom furniture and spaces in the Mexico, a company where contemporary culture is lived and breathed. From the beginning, the brand has developed its collections in collaboration with renowned designers, architects and artists, and in Antropología collection they collaborate with Raúl de la Cerda.
Raul designed Anthropología, a family of benches and tables / stools made of American oak and black marble, inspired by the geometry, repetition and simplicity of the prehistoric pieces observed in the Museum of Anthropology of the City of Mexico.
Raul de la Cerda is an interdisciplinary designer originally from Mexico City formed in Mexico, Paris and Madrid. Since 2016 Raul runs his design studio RAUL DE LA CERDA ESTUDIO, as well as being creative director of Artelinea.
Raul's work goes back to the origin of the materials he uses most: wood, stone and metal. He does not hide his designs under indirect layers, but reduces them to their essence. His inspiration is life, the continuous curiosity for things, travel, art, his family, the people around him, his country; Mexico, its history and the passion and desire to have to do different things.
